The walk is fine in three frames, because we imagine the middle frames being accurate and cycling. The middle frames you added, though, aren't the walk cycle - they're the slide cycle.
Just look at the animated run cycles lying around for the missing frames - if you're making it more than three, you need the 'heel drags ground back, bent knee in background' and 'bent knee with raised foot in foreground, background heel drags back' frames. As is you're watching the foot slip backwards and forward, as typically happens with fewer frames, and of course that won't feel right.
Adding arms will certainly help the illusion so you're less likely to pick at it, though.
